So let’s pretend it’s still the holiday season, and move on. 馃槢 This is the winter 2018/2019 collection by CND, called Night Moves. It’s a collection filled with shimmering shades, that were perfect not only for the holiday season, but all winter long. The shades I received from the brand for testing are: Kiss of Fire #288, which is the red one, the one I wore on my nails for Christmas and looked amazing, Soiree Strut #289, which is the shimmery champagne color, and then After Hours #291, the silver one.
